Folks at vulnerabilityassessment.co.uk pointed us to a new really good software for footprinting just released by Roelof Temmingh, ex-SensePost founder (sensepost released some beautiful tools as well as bidiblah, suru and wikto)

Changes
- New look
- Added checks for people/email on Flickr and a Yahoo ID.
- Added 5 transforms to extract info from PGP key servers - these work really well: Person2Email,Person2Person,Domain2Person,Domain2Email,Email2Person. So, if you ever sent your PGP key to a key server - you’re on Evolution
- GUI expected by the end of May.
